Welcome to crime data report for Mount Savage, Maryland, an area with a population of 639 residents. In this data exploration, we will delve into the crime statistics of Mount Savage, Maryland shedding light on its safety and security. The closest law enforcement agency from Mount Savage is Allegany County Sheriff's Office (MD0010000) approximately around 8.02 miles away from the center of Mount Savage.
This analysis uses the latest crime data submitted by Allegany County Sheriff's Office to the FBI National Incident-Based Reporting System (NIBRS).
Note: In area with small number of population such as Mount Savage, the data might be skewed in infrequent crimes such as homicide, rape, and arson.

Total Crime in Mount Savage, Maryland
A comprehensive overview of the overall crime landscape, covering a range of different criminal activities within a specific region.
Chart of Total Crime in Mount Savage, Maryland from 2012 to 2022
In Mount Savage, the crime rate displayed an increase, bottoming out in 2013 (1713.53) and peaking in 2015(17510.08). The crime rate in United States demonstrated a decreasing trend, reaching its peak in 2013 (3519.17) and then reaching its lowest level in 2021 (1689.67). The crime rate in Maryland displayed a downward trajectory in trend, reaching its peak in 2012 (3126.05) and subsequently hitting a trough in 2021 (690.27).
A 174.33% higher total crime rate in Mount Savage compared to the state average (6627.27 vs 2415.78) highlights a concerning trend. Crime was 127.55% more problematic compared to the national average (6627.27 vs 2912.43).
Violent Crime in Mount Savage, Maryland
Insights into intense and forceful criminal acts, including assault, robbery, homicide, and rape, shedding light on the most serious offenses.
Chart of Violent Crime in Mount Savage, Maryland from 2012 to 2022
The crime rate in Mount Savage demonstrated a decreasing trend, reaching its peak in 2012 (2091.34) and then reaching its lowest level in 2020 (518.87). The crime rate in United States demonstrated a decreasing trend, reaching its peak in 2016 (446.76) and then reaching its lowest level in 2021 (281.24). The trend in Maryland exhibited a declining pattern, with the peak occurring in 2017 (489.46) and the bottom point reached in 2021 (111.65).
The state average was surpassed by Mount Savage in terms of violent crime rate, showing a 261.1% difference (1477.24 vs 409.1). Crime was 263.91% more problematic compared to the national average (1477.24 vs 405.94).
